Papal Blessing: LaPorta’s Honeymoon Takes a Holy Turn With Personal Audience From Pope Leo XIV

A Touchdown of a Different Kind

Fresh off his intimate Catholic wedding, Detroit Lions tight end Sam LaPorta has found himself basking in something far more spiritual than a playoff victory. While honeymooning in Italy with his new wife, Callahan, LaPorta was granted a once-in-a-lifetime moment: a personal blessing from Pope Leo XIV himself.

And yes, it was every bit as touching—and Instagram-worthy—as you might imagine.


The Vatican Visit: A Blessing Beyond the Field

Wearing a sharp brown suit, LaPorta stood humbly beside Callahan, who looked stunning in a flowy white dress with a floral headband. Together, they received a heartfelt prayer and blessing from the Holy Father, surrounded by pilgrims and admirers lined up at the Vatican.

LaPorta shared the sacred moment on Instagram, captioning:

“Thank you to a very busy man for blessing me and my bride. A special moment we’ll never forget.”

The post quickly made waves—not just among fans of the Lions, but also among followers of football and faith alike.
